中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

C++循環隊列在算法競賽中的應用

c++
小樊
82
2024-07-14 10:23:24
欄目: 編程語言

C++循環隊列在算法競賽中經常用于解決一些需要快速插入和刪除元素的問題,比如廣度優先搜索(BFS)、滑動窗口等問題。循環隊列可以在O(1)的時間復雜度內進行插入和刪除操作,相比于使用數組或鏈表實現的隊列,在處理大量數據時效率更高。

在算法競賽中,通常使用STL中的queue來實現隊列操作,但有時需要更高效的操作來處理大規模數據,這時可以選擇使用自己實現的循環隊列。通過使用C++語言的特性,可以很容易地實現循環隊列,提高算法的效率。

總的來說,C++循環隊列在算法競賽中的應用主要體現在處理大規模數據時提高效率,特別是在需要頻繁插入和刪除元素的情況下,循環隊列能夠更好地滿足算法需求。

0
福州市| 大渡口区| 定安县| 顺义区| 北安市| 深州市| 民和| 永川市| 定安县| 通山县| 钟祥市| 宕昌县| 武汉市| 宁晋县| 光山县| 西藏| 京山县| 岐山县| 达拉特旗| 茶陵县| 恩施市| 萨嘎县| 津南区| 敦化市| 萨迦县| 玉树县| 太保市| 屏边| 贵德县| 攀枝花市| 城口县| 韶关市| 桦川县| 铜山县| 宁武县| 琼结县| 永春县| 麻栗坡县| 竹山县| 青海省| 平阴县|